Warm air from the vents, long afternoon run times, or an AC that never reaches the thermostat setting can point to several problems. Restricted airflow, a dirty coil, or low refrigerant may be involved. Outdoor-unit trouble or a control problem can cause the same kind of hot-house call. Letting it run this way can add strain while your home stays hot. The right repair should address the cause and help the system cool normally again.
